Description

STAT3-IN-44 is a potent STAT3 inhibitor with IC50s of 1.84 (C6 cells) and 4.81 μM (A549 cells). STAT3-IN-44 inhibits STAT3 phosphorylation, downregulates Bcl-2, and upregulates Caspase-3 to promote late-stage apoptosis. STAT3-IN-44 significantly suppresses tumor cell proliferation and migration. STAT3-IN-44 can be used for the study of cancers such as glioma and lung cancer[1].

In Vitro

STAT3-IN-44 (Compound 18q) (10 μM, 24-48 h) significantly induces the proportion of apoptotic C6 cells through the STAT3-Bcl-2/Caspase-3 pathway[1].
STAT3-IN-44 (2.5-10 μM, 10 days) almost completely inhibits colony formation at a concentration of 10 μM in C6 cells[1].
STAT3-IN-44 (10 μM, 24 h) significantly inhibits the migration of C6 cells[1].
STAT3-IN-44 (50 μM, 37-70°C) significantly enhances the thermal stability of STAT3 in C6 cells[1].

Apoptosis Analysis[1]

Cell Line: C6 cells
Concentration: 2.5, 5, 10 μM
Incubation Time: 24 h
Result: Revealed distinct apoptotic features, including chromatin condensation and apoptotic body formation.
Significantly increased the number of apoptotic cells and late apoptotic cells.

Western Blot Analysis[1]

Cell Line: C6 cells
Concentration: 2.5, 5, 10 μM
Incubation Time: 48 h
Result: Reduced the phosphorylation of STAT3, while the total STAT3 was almost unchanged.
Downregulated the expression of Bcl-2 and upregulated cleaved Caspase-3.

Cell Migration Assay [1]

Cell Line: C6 cells
Concentration: 2.5, 5, 10 μM
Incubation Time: 24 h
Result: Significantly inhibited cell migration.
